with excel tables (internal or external) you can paranmetrize all aspects of the part file or together. provided the data you need to manage is already inside the file.
to understand, if you have to manage the diameter of the impeller that quota must be present in the drawing. inside the excel sheet you can obviously do all the calculations you need, use the functions and what else the sheet makes you available.

In any case, in the data table that commands the parameters of the various configurations of the part (to tell us what you call "a series of similar impellers obtained by varying the project data") you can insert the values of the individual cells or columns as links to the respective cells of an external excel sheet. because the changes that you attach to the data in the external sheet are applied to the inner sheet of swx you have to open it by entering into "change the table" and the external excel file must be opened and saved. when you close the data table you save all parameters in each configuration
eye inserting cells connected to external sheets then requires some attention in working on the data source file to avoid incans of the same in the data table swx
